The Art of Crafting Rote Bete Feta

The production of traditional rote bete feta is an intricate process that demands meticulous attention to detail. The finest feta is produced from a blend of sheep's and goat's milk, though cow's milk is sometimes used as an alternative. The milk is gently heated and coagulated with rennet, an enzyme that causes the milk solids to separate from the whey. The curds are then cut into small cubes and left to drain, allowing the excess whey to escape.

Pairing Possibilities

Feta's versatility extends to its pairing potential. It harmonizes effortlessly with a diverse range of flavors, from the sweetness of honey to the acidity of vinegar. When paired with fresh herbs such as oregano, thyme, and basil, feta's flavor profile takes on a vibrant and aromatic dimension.
